9 Staying stylish tips!

We’re late, we’re broke, we’re too busy to think about it…but does that really mean we can’t dress well anymore? And when did dressing down become a fashion statement? GLAMOUR’s fashion director, Bronwyn Day gives us 9 tips to help you stay stylish:

 

1: Allocate a monthly allowance to your wardrobe to stop splurging and buy wisely.

 

2: Check the weather and plan your outfit the night before –you’re sure to look put together!

 

3: Dress according to your mood, but also your diary. (Meeting? After-work cocktails?).

 

4: Keep a pair of neutral heels in a bag under your desk for those ‘just in case’ moments.

 

5: Stay on top of trends and get clued up on styling by reading magazines and blogs.

 

6: Know your body and assets, and dress to highlight ’em – just not too much!

 

7: Invest in these classics: a neutral trench coat, black or brown leather bag, statement jewellery, a fabulous cocktail dress in black or cream (timeless colours!), a crisp shirt, tailored trousers, a cardigan and jeans that flatter your shape. Done!

 

8: Keep a neat coif with a trim every six weeks. Failing all else, be sure to keep locks clean.

 

9: Whatever happens, stay appropriate. Don’t let your sweatpants make it to work. Ever.
